Barn Doors Repair in Kansas City, KS
Barn doors repair services address issues with sliding barn doors commonly found in homes and properties throughout Kansas City, KS. These services cover a variety of projects, including fixing misaligned or stuck doors, repairing damaged or broken hardware, restoring smooth sliding functions, and addressing issues with the door’s frame or track system. Property owners often seek these repairs to improve functionality, enhance aesthetic appeal, or restore the door’s original operation after wear and tear. Understanding the specific problem-such as whether the door is off its track, has hardware that needs replacement, or requires realignment-helps property owners communicate their needs clearly before requesting service.
Before requesting barn doors repair, property owners should consider the type of barn door they have, the extent of the damage or malfunction, and any specific features like hardware style or track system. Knowing whether the door is wooden, metal, or composite, along with details about its mounting and operation, can facilitate a more accurate assessment. Additionally, understanding if the issue is ongoing or a recent problem can help determine the appropriate scope of repairs needed. Clear information about the current condition of the door and its hardware ensures that the repair process can be as efficient and effective as possible.

Barn Doors Repair Questions
What types of barn door repairs are commonly needed? Repairs often include fixing misaligned tracks, replacing damaged panels, or addressing issues with hardware and rollers.
Can barn doors be repaired if they are off-track? Yes, off-track barn doors can usually be realigned or adjusted to restore proper operation.
What signs indicate a barn door needs repair? Common signs include difficulty opening or closing, squeaking noises, or visible damage to the door or hardware.
Are repairs suitable for all barn door materials? Repairs can typically be performed on various materials such as wood, metal, or composite, depending on the specific issue.
